Output 89c339742a0154ab5243106109803cdb851d6a2093ef4add91bfe9646b7fbb8f:1

value
620391
script pubkey
OP_0 OP_PUSHBYTES_20 49f34415e6180e9686509e347d569dbc73cd824a
address
bc1qf8e5g90xrq8fdpjsnc68645ah3eumqj22hftqj
transaction
89c339742a0154ab5243106109803cdb851d6a2093ef4add91bfe9646b7fbb8f
spent
true